  • Description
    Asenapine maleate (Org 5222) is a potent psychopharmacologic agent that shows high affinity for 5-HT, dopamine, histamine and adrenoceptors; shows much lower affinity (pKi<5) for muscarinic receptor; behaves as a potent antagonist 5-HT receptors (5-HT2A pKB=9.0), dopaime and adrenoceptors; shows strong antipsychotic potential in vivo.Schizophrenia Approved(In Vitro):Relative to its D2 receptor affinity, asenapine has a higher affinity for 5-HT2C, 5-HT2A, 5-HT2B, 5-HT7, 5-HT6, α2B and D3 receptors, suggesting stronger engagement of these targets at therapeutic doses. Asenapine behaves as a potent antagonist (pKB) at 5-HT1A (7.4), 5-HT1B (8.1), 5-HT2A (9.0), 5-HT2B (9.3), 5-HT2C (9.0), 5-HT6 (8.0), 5-HT7 (8.5), D2 (9.1), D3 (9.1), α2A (7.3), α2B (8.3), α2C (6.8) and H1 (8.4) receptors.(In Vivo):Asenapine is an atypical antipsychotic that is currently available for the treatment of schizophrenia and bipolar I disorder. Asenapine may have superior therapeutic effect on anxiety symptoms than other agents in rats. Asenapine has anxiolytic-like effects in the EPM and the defensive marble burying tests in mice.
